    There comes a point in a custom keyboard aficionado's life, when you graduate from the stock Gateron Browns that came with your first mechanical keyboard. But what to do with a perfectly working sample of Gateron Browns? These almost linear-tactiles - "Lacktiles" are not that great out of the gate, but they do posses a lower housing that happens to work great when paired with another switch... the NK Cream Linears.
    The result is an interestingly clacky linear switch, that is smoother than a NK Cream, but with its own distinct feel and sound. They produce a sound that is almost like shaking a rattle can of spray paint, or even a tiny little crab walking across the table.

    KBDFANS D65 Aluminum - E-White
    Full Brass Plate + KBD67 MK II Hot-Swap RGB PCB
    Foam: KBDFANS KBD67 MK II Pre-Cut Case + Plate
    Creameron + TX 65G L Spring + KEBO films + Krytox 205G0
    Keycaps: PBT Double-Shot Olivia Clones
    Stabilizers: Durock V2 Screw-In + Krytox 205g0 + Permatex

    Does the scratchiness of the NK creams go away. How does the smoothness compare to other switches like tangerines or lubed gat yellows?

    • @Keybored
      @Keybored  3 ปีที่แล้ว

      Hi Nabil! I have been told that to make NK creams truly smooth, you have to use them unlubed for some time to really break them in, then lube them. Apparently the process takes a few weeks, and I never had the patience to do it :) I feel the Creams are similar or slightly worse than gateron yellows and there is absolutely no comparison against the tangerine. Tangerines are one of the smoothest switches out there right now :)

    does cherry bottom work as well?

    • @Keybored
      @Keybored  3 ปีที่แล้ว

      Hi kurisu! The cherry bottom housing will work, but the sound signature will vary. I believe the Cherry black housings have a nice deep sound signature, so will not sound exactly the same as the gateron housing. Only challenge will be finding a smooth cherry bottom housing, because some tend to be a bit scratchy. Hope that helps!

    so was it the change of springs and film that changed how it acts and sounds? or the housing? cause all it seemed changed was the spring and film, nothing about the actual key.

    • @Keybored
      @Keybored  3 ปีที่แล้ว

      Hi thisjustanother! The biggest change comes from using the gateron lower housing with the cream stem. The gat lower housing is smoother than the cream lower housing and also has a different sound profile as well. Hope that helps!

    I think the reason people throw cream stems in other housings is the same as using Halo stems for HPs, they both have slightly longer stems which change the bottom out sound in whatever housing they're thrown in. I love how these pop but didn't like the strong tactility of HPs, need to get me some creams and throw them in cherry housings:))

    • @Keybored
      @Keybored  3 ปีที่แล้ว

      Hi tiang! You are correct! The cream stem is essentially a linear halo stem. Great for modding!
